Long launches Adult Restorative Justice Strategy consultation

Alliance Justice Minister Naomi Long has launched a consultation for a proposed Adult Restorative Justice Strategy. The consultation will consider the development of a strategic approach to restorative practices at all stages of the criminal justice system, from early intervention in the community, formal diversion by statutory agencies, court-ordered disposals, custody and reintegration.
